Microsoft Office 2007 12.0.6015.5000 and MSO 12.0.6017.5000 do not sign the metadata of Office Open XML (OOXML) documents, which makes it easier for remote attackers to modify Dublin Core metadata fields, as demonstrated by the (1) LastModifiedBy and (2) creator fields in docProps/core.xml in the OOXML ZIP container.

Risk analysis

Based on its CVSS vector, this vulnerability is exploitable over the network, low attack complexity, requiring no authentication. Successful exploitation leads to partial impact to confidentiality, partial impact to integrity.

Its EPSS score of 15.6% reflects a moderate probability of exploitation activity in the wild over the next 30 days, placing it above 96% of all scored CVEs.
